Hi @HoneyLover A ferw things you could try, I am taking it that a soft Reset does not make any difference.
If you dial *#0*# a number of tests will be displayed including the various colour panels, cycle through them to see if it helps.
You could try in Safe Mode as if the line not present there would indicate a conflict with 3rd party app/theme. You could then delete recemt third party apps if applicable. https://www.samsung.com/uk/support/mobile-devices/how-to-start-my-galaxy-device-in-safe-mode/
However this may well be a hardware error which would need an inspection, could contact support https://www.samsung.com/uk/support/ or obviously alternatively you can upgrade.

Personally I would look at the repair costs to that of how long the phone is going to be supported in regards to software updates and security patches, so then you can make an informed decision.
I assune your have no alternative insurance through any Home Contents Insurance and or some Banks provide cover as a perk of the account.
